The Pigeons du Sable are maintaining a link to their past by playing Gnawa music, a ritual music that was brought to Morocco from slaves of Sub-Saharan Africa. The heart of the Gnawa instrumentation is the guembri, a 3 stringed lute that plays a bass line. Although we also hear the drum (ganga), metal castanets (qraqeb), and hand clapping, it is the trance inducing chants that makes this CD great. 65 minutes.
